MAINTENANCE SCHEDULE

Your vehicle is equipped with an automatic oil change

indicator system. The oil change indicator system will

remind you that it is time to take your vehicle in for

scheduled maintenance.
Based on engine operation conditions, the oil change

indicator message will illuminate. This means that ser-

vice is required for your vehicle. Operating conditions

such as frequent short-trips, trailer tow, extremely hot or

cold ambient temperatures will influence when the “Oil

Change Required” message is displayed. Severe Operat-

ing Conditions can cause the change oil message to

illuminate as early as 3,500 miles (5,600 km) since last

reset. Have your vehicle serviced as soon as possible,

within the next 500 miles (805 km).
Your authorized dealer will reset the oil change indicator

message after completing the scheduled oil change. If a

scheduled oil change is performed by someone other

than your authorized dealer, the message can be reset by

referring to the steps described under “Electronic Vehicle

Information Center (EVIC)” in “Understanding Your

Instrument Panel” for further information.
NOTE:

Under no circumstances should oil change inter-

vals exceed 10,000 miles (16,000 km) or twelve months,

whichever comes first.
Once A Month Or Before A Long Trip:

• Check engine oil level
• Check windshield washer fluid level
• Check the tire inflation pressures and look for unusual

wear or damage

• Check the fluid levels of the coolant reservoir, brake

master cylinder, power steering and transmission as

needed

• Check function of all interior and exterior lights
